It's one of the first questions I ask of a new client and so many say that they took the risk because they had been made redundant etc and it gave them the 'push' or ultimatum to either look for another job or do something they had considered anyway. Many of them have successful businesses now so I would say "What made you start your own business" was either that it was the opportunity or (second most often given reason) that you feel you can 'do it better' than your employer and want to earn what they do from you! I've met plenty of those guys as well!

Haven't met so many who didn't start out as an employee.

1. What made you want to start your own business?
I was waiting for a major op. My doctor, my specialist and the occupational health doctor (who worked for my employer) all supported me however my employer gave me three months to reduce my sick leave knowing that it was impossible for me to do so before I'd had my op. I ended up in a terrible state at which point my mum in law stepped in and suggested I resigned and worked for her on line business from home, after a couple of months she suggested I started my own on line business.

2. Did you expect it to be the way it is right now?
At the time I was in too much of a state to think about what kind of future the business had but I'm really pleased with how far it's come in a short space of time and what I've managed to achieve.

3. How has it affected your life?
Gradually I'm getting my confidence back and I thoroughly enjoy being my own boss.

4. What sacrifice did you make before starting out?
I gave up a well paid job having worked there for 18 years, although it was a "jump before you are pushed" scenario!

5. What would you be doing if you had not taken the plunge?
My employer had already started disciplinary action and was moving towards sacking me if I didn't reduce my sick leave in three months. As my op wasn't until five months down the line I would imagine I'd be out of work looking for someone prepared to take me on with a horrendous sick record.
